What is an M3U List?

Before diving into where to find them, it is important to understand what they are. An M3U file (Moving Picture Experts Group Audio Layer 3 Uniform Resource Locator) is essentially a text file that contains the URLs of media files.

In the context of IPTV, an M3U list acts as a digital guidebook. It tells your media player (like VLC, Kodi, or IPTV Smarters) where to find specific live TV channels, movies, or radio stations from around the world. Instead of storing the video files, the list simply points the player to the stream.

The Digital Stream: Unpacking the Phenomenon of "IPTV M3U Lists on Telegram"

In the modern era of digital consumption, the way we access television and media content has undergone a radical transformation. The traditional model of linear broadcasting—dependent on fixed schedules and expensive cable subscriptions—has been disrupted by Internet Protocol Television (IPTV). As viewers seek more autonomy and affordability, a specific, illicit subculture has emerged at the intersection of file sharing and instant messaging. A search for "iptv m3u list telegram top" reveals not just a query for free television, but a complex ecosystem defined by technical ingenuity, a cat-and-mouse game of copyright enforcement, and the shifting expectations of the modern consumer.

To understand the phenomenon, one must first understand the mechanics. IPTV itself is a legitimate technology used by mainstream providers to deliver television content over the internet. However, in the colloquial sense, "IPTV" often refers to unauthorized streams. The "M3U list" is the key that unlocks this content. Technically, an M3U file is simply a plain text file that points to the location of audio or video files. In the context of piracy, an M3U list acts as a digital map, guiding a media player (such as VLC or TiviMate) to thousands of live TV channels, movies, and pay-per-view events hosted on illicit servers. For the user, the barrier to entry is low; the technology is accessible, and the reward—instant access to a global library of content—is high.

The role of Telegram in this ecosystem cannot be overstated. While torrenting relied on specialized software and search engines, the distribution of IPTV lists has migrated to encrypted messaging platforms, with Telegram serving as the primary hub. Telegram’s architecture—allowing for massive groups of up to 200,000 members and channels with unlimited subscribers—makes it an ideal distribution platform for "top" lists. These channels operate as curators, aggregating links from various sources and posting updated M3U lists daily or even hourly. The search term "top" reflects the user's desire for quality control; unlike the early days of piracy where dead links were common, modern users seek curated lists with 4K resolution, high uptime, and minimal buffering. Telegram channels gamify this, with admins acting as gatekeepers of quality, pruning dead links and responding to user requests.

However, this convenience masks a volatile and often predatory environment. The search for "top" lists often leads users into a minefield of deception. Because these channels operate in a legal gray area, they are often monetized through intrusive advertising. Users hunting for a free subscription to a premium sports channel may find themselves clicking through a labyrinth of URL shorteners, popup ads, and phishing schemes. Furthermore, the transient nature of piracy means that "top" lists expire quickly. Copyright holders employ bots to scan for and shut down unauthorized streams, meaning an M3U list that works in the morning may be useless by the evening. This necessitates a constant cycle of searching, downloading, and updating, turning the passive act of watching TV into an active pursuit of functioning links.
